Contentfulを使ってみた所感

#プログラミング

#Contentful

投稿日: 2020-09-13

Note: 他のHeadless CMSは使ったことないので単体での所感です。

いいところ

  • まあまあ直感的に使える
    • 管理画面から簡単にContent Modelを定義したりできる
  • 機能が豊富
    • 正直全然追い切れていない
  • 無料でもかなり使える
  • 有名
  • JSのSDKがTSに対応している
  • コンテンツを更新したときに過去のversionが残る(全部残るのかは不明)

おしいところ

  • TSの型はあるけど、クエリオプションがany型。
    • 型定義が難しそうなので仕方ないのかもしれない。
  • Reference(Link)型のArrayを持つフィールドに対して特定の値を持つものがあるかどうかでマッチング、みたいなクエリができない。(Reference以外のArrayならできる)
    • その代わり?どこから参照されてるかの一覧を取得する機能はある。
  • 機能が多い分仕方ないけど、何ができて何ができないのかがちょっとわかりにくいと思った。

Author

profile icon

тars (たーず)

tars0x9752

Japan, Tokyo

TypeScript

プログラミング, 音楽, Turntablism, Video Game, スノーボード, 味噌汁(特に赤味噌), 味噌煮込みうどん, 川魚(特に鮎)

Tags

#Contentful

#Domain

#Gandi

#Git

#GitHub

#KaTeX

#Linux

#Markdown

#Next.js

#Nix

#Nix Flakes

#NixOS

#OCaml

#PEG

#Phenyl

#React

#SVG

#Terminal

#Turntablism

#TypeScript

#VSCode

#Vercel

#WSL

#Windows

#Yarn

#Yoyo

#lsp

#npm

#sitemap

#アルゴリズム

#データ構造

#プログラミング

#携帯

#数学

#映画

#競技プログラミング

#雑記

#音楽